Data Privacy Risk Management

The identification and mitigation of risks related to unauthorized collection, use, disclosure, or breach of personal and sensitive information.

Full definition
Data privacy risk management addresses regulatory compliance, reputational damage, and consumer trust issues arising from handling personal data. Organizations implement privacy by design, conduct privacy impact assessments, establish data governance, and deploy technical controls like encryption and access restrictions. For instance, a healthcare provider must manage patient data under HIPAA, implementing safeguards, training staff, and responding to breaches within regulatory timelines. With regulations like GDPR, CCPA, and emerging laws worldwide, data privacy risk management has become a critical component of enterprise risk management and cybersecurity programs.
